A Mysterious Double Murder in Encino: What Really Happened?

Encino, USAThu Jul 24 2025

In a quiet Encino neighborhood, a shocking crime unfolded. A man, Raymond Boodarian, is accused of a brutal act. He allegedly used the victims' own gun to end their lives. The victims, Robin Kaye and Thomas Deluca, were both 70 years old. They were well-known figures, with Robin Kaye being a music supervisor for "American Idol."

Discovery of the Bodies

The discovery of the bodies was delayed. It took four days for anyone to notice something was wrong. A neighbor finally called the police. They had not seen or heard from the couple for days. When police arrived, they found the bodies inside the home. The couple had been dead since July 10.

Charges Against Boodarian

Boodarian, just 22 years old, is now facing serious charges. He is accused of:

  • Two counts of murder
  • One count of burglary

If found guilty, he could spend the rest of his life in prison. The details of the case are disturbing. According to reports, Boodarian called 911 after the crime. He even gave his name to the police, which helped them track him down.

Timeline of Events

The timeline of events is crucial:

  • July 10: A neighbor reported seeing a man trying to break into the couple's home.
  • About 40 minutes later: Another call came in. The caller said someone had broken into their office. The caller pleaded, "Please don't shoot me." It is unclear who made this second call. It could have been Boodarian or one of the victims.
